Cassandra数据的一致性和分区容忍性问题怎么解决

1585
2024/3/15 13:57:23
栏目: 云计算
开发者测试专用服务器限时活动,0元免费领,库存有限,领完即止! 点击查看>>

Cassandra 数据的一致性和分区容忍性问题可以通过以下方法来解决:

  1. 使用复制策略:Cassandra 提供了多种复制策略,可以在数据的多个副本之间实现一致性。可以配置每个数据中心的副本数量,以确保数据能够在节点之间正确复制。

  2. 使用一致性级别:Cassandra 支持不同的一致性级别,例如 ALL、QUORUM、LOCAL_QUORUM 等。通过调整一致性级别,可以在数据的可用性和一致性之间进行权衡。

  3. 使用故障检测和自动修复:Cassandra 提供了故障检测和自动修复功能,可以自动检测和修复节点或副本之间的数据不一致问题。

  4. 监控和调优:定期监控集群的状态和性能,及时发现和解决一致性和分区容忍性问题。

通过以上方法,可以有效提高 Cassandra 数据的一致性和分区容忍性,确保数据在分布式环境中的正确性和可靠性。

辰迅云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>

推荐阅读: Cassandra怎么处理分布式存储和水平扩展